WebThe Western Ghats zone is one of the world's 25 biodiversity 'hotspots' and one of India's major tropical evergreen forested regions, with enormous plant diversity. The region is home to nearly 4000 species of flowering plants, accounting for nearly 27% of India's total flora. 1500 of these species are endemic. WebOver-exploitation of species: Unsustainable use of ecosystems and over-exploitation of biodiversity are a major reason behind biodiversity loss. Over-hunting or poaching of species, overfishing and overharvesting of plant products can quickly lead to a decline in biodiversity.
